Do you want to have what you think about me spoiled, Mr.Russell ?" "Oh, but that's already far beyond reach," he said, lightly.
"But it can't be!" she protested.
"Why not ?" "Because it never can be.

Men don't change their minds about one another often: they make it quite an event when they do, and talk about it as if something important had happened.

But a girl only has to go down-town with a shoe-string unfastened, and every man who sees her will change his mind about her.

Don't you know that's true ?" "Not of myself, I think." "There!" she cried.

"That's precisely what every man in the world would say!" "So you wouldn't trust me ?" "Well--I'll be awfully worried if you give 'em a chance to tell you that I'm too lazy to tie my shoe-strings!" He laughed delightedly.
